Stone spreading services involve the application and leveling of various types of loose stone materials across outdoor surfaces. This process typically includes spreading gravel, crushed stone, or decorative stones to create a stable, well-drained surface for driveways, pathways, patios, or landscaping features. The work often involves preparing the area, ensuring proper compaction, and achieving an even, durable finish that enhances both the function and appearance of outdoor spaces. Local contractors specializing in stone spreading can tailor the material and method to suit specific property needs and aesthetic preferences.
This service helps solve common problems such as poor drainage, uneven surfaces, or unstable ground conditions that can lead to erosion or difficulty in maintaining outdoor areas. For example, properties with muddy or rutted pathways may benefit from stone spreading to create a firm, permeable surface that reduces mud and prevents water pooling. Additionally, stone spreading can help improve the longevity of driveways and walkways by providing a stable base that resists shifting or cracking over time. The overview below groups typical Stone Spreading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or stone spreading jobs generally fall between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s and touch-ups land within this range, making it a common choice for homeowners seeking affordable solutions.
Standard Projects - larger, more comprehensive stone spreading services usually cost between $600 and $1,500. Most moderate projects fall into this band, with fewer extending into higher price ranges for more extensive work.
Large-Scale Installations - extensive stone spreading work, such as driveway or patio installations, can range from $1,500 to $3,500. These projects often involve more labor and materials, leading to higher costs that are typical for complex jobs.
Full Replacement or Complex Jobs - the most involved projects, including complete surface overhauls, can reach $3,500 or more. While less common, these larger, more detailed jobs tend to push into the highest cost ranges among local service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is stone spreading service? Stone spreading service involves the application and distribution of gravel or stone materials across a designated area, often for landscaping, driveways, or pathways, to create a stable and durable surface.
How do local contractors prepare for stone spreading projects? Contractors typically assess the area, remove existing debris or vegetation if necessary, and prepare the surface to ensure proper compaction and even distribution of the stone material.
What types of stone materials are used in spreading services? Common materials include crushed gravel, limestone, granite, and other aggregates suitable for the specific project requirements and desired finish.
Are there different techniques used for stone spreading? Yes, techniques vary depending on the project size and purpose, including manual spreading, mechanical equipment, and specialized spreading tools to achieve an even layer.
